Eucalyptus oil has high levels of the same type of aromatic phenols that make even just cedar wood a dangerous choice for reptiles. It's not really a safe choice in any amount :/ Eucalyptus oil likely has at least some efficacy against microorganisms, but that same mechanism will irritate the lungs and damage the liver and kidneys. One of the biggest challenges in medicine is to get something that is targeted to the undesired organism rather than just something that is efficacious against the undesired organism but also does damage to the host. Please at least consider the potential side effects of using eucalyptus oil that can't be readily seen.
